Discover the ultimate **Best Carrot Cake Recipe**, a true classic bursting with the natural sweetness of carrots, crunchy nuts, and juicy pineapple. Crowned with a luxurious cream cheese frosting, this dessert is an irresistible delight, perfect for any celebration, especially birthdays.
My journey with this phenomenal dessert began back in the vibrant 1970s, thanks to my culinary-adventurous parents. After savoring incredibly moist slices of **Carrot Cake with Pineapple** during a memorable trip to St. Paul, they returned home with the precious recipe, eager to recreate that magic in our family kitchen. Little did I know, this would soon become a cherished family tradition and my absolute favorite dessert.

Why This Carrot Cake Recipe is an Absolute Must-Try
There are countless reasons why this isn’t just *another* carrot cake recipe, but *the* carrot cake recipe you’ll keep coming back to. It’s a recipe steeped in tradition, perfected over decades, and guaranteed to earn rave reviews from everyone who tastes it.
- A Timeless Family Legacy: This exact recipe has been a staple in my family since the early 1980s. Through countless gatherings and special occasions, it has consistently proven itself to be the most delicious carrot cake anyone has ever tasted. Its enduring popularity is a testament to its unparalleled flavor and texture.
- Unrivaled Moisture and Density: Unlike some drier counterparts, this recipe uses vegetable oil, ensuring an incredibly moist and perfectly dense crumb every single time. The oil contributes to a tenderness that butter alone can’t achieve, creating a cake that practically melts in your mouth without being overly delicate.
- A Symphony of Flavors and Textures: Prepare for a flavor explosion! This cake is generously packed with finely pureed carrots, tender shredded coconut, crunchy pecans, and bright, tangy crushed pineapple. Each bite offers a delightful medley of sweet, savory, and nutty notes, with contrasting textures that keep things exciting.
- The Iconic Cream Cheese Frosting: And then, there’s the frosting. Just three words truly capture its essence: Cream Cheese Frosting. It’s rich, creamy, perfectly sweet with a subtle tang, and utterly decadent. This luscious topping is not merely an accompaniment; it’s an integral part of the experience, elevating the cake to legendary status.
My initial encounter with carrot cake was met with a healthy dose of skepticism. As a teenager, the idea of a dessert named after a vegetable seemed, well, peculiar. However, my mom was a culinary pioneer in our Iowa household, introducing us to “exotic” dishes like paella, baklava, and wontons. Her adventurous spirit had always paid off, so my hesitation about this carrot cake lasted only a brief second. From that first innocent bite, any doubts vanished, and this carrot cake recipe quickly ascended to the top of my favorite desserts list, a position it has held ever since.
Mastering Your Ingredients: Key Notes for the Perfect Carrot Cake
The secret to an exceptional carrot cake lies in understanding your ingredients and preparing them correctly. Here’s a detailed guide to ensure every component contributes to culinary perfection:
- Kitchen Staples (Flour, Sugar, Salt, Cinnamon, Vegetable Oil): These foundational ingredients form the backbone of your cake. Use all-purpose flour for consistency. Granulated sugar provides sweetness and moisture. Salt balances the flavors, while cinnamon adds that quintessential warm spice. For vegetable oil, canola oil is an excellent choice due to its neutral flavor and ability to create a super moist cake.
- Baking Powder (Potency Check is Crucial): Baking powder is your primary leavening agent, responsible for the cake’s rise. Unlike baking soda, its potency can diminish over time. Always check the expiration date. To perform a quick freshness test, place a spoonful in a cup of very hot water. If it bubbles vigorously, it’s still active. If not, it’s time to replace it to ensure your cake rises beautifully.
- Eggs (Room Temperature for Best Results): I always recommend using large eggs. Bringing them to room temperature before mixing is a small but significant step. Room temperature eggs emulsify more easily with the other ingredients, leading to a smoother batter and a more evenly textured, consistent cake. Beat them slightly before adding for better incorporation.
- Vanilla Extract (Invest in Quality): The quality of your vanilla extract can profoundly impact the flavor of your cake. Always opt for real vanilla extract, avoiding artificially flavored versions. The complex notes of genuine vanilla add depth and warmth that simply cannot be replicated by imitations. Nielsen-Massey is a trusted brand known for its exceptional vanilla.
- Chopped Pecans (Toast for Enhanced Flavor): Nuts add a wonderful crunch and rich flavor. To truly unlock their essential oils and deepen their nutty aroma, take a few minutes to toast your chopped pecans. This can be done in a dry skillet over medium heat or spread on a baking sheet in a preheated oven until fragrant. If you have a nut allergy or simply prefer a nut-free cake, they can be easily omitted without compromising the cake’s overall quality. You’ll need extra pecans if you plan to garnish the sides of your finished cake.
- Shredded Coconut (Sweetened is Key): Shredded coconut contributes a delightful chewy texture and tropical sweetness. I find that Angelflake sweetened coconut works best, adding just the right amount of sweetness and moisture to the cake.
- Carrots (Pureed for Even Distribution): For the smoothest texture and most even distribution of carrot flavor, this recipe calls for pureed cooked carrots. Peel your carrots, slice them, and simmer in water until they are tender enough to be easily pureed. This method ensures that every bite has that lovely carrot essence without large, chewy pieces.
- Crushed Pineapple (Drain Thoroughly): Crushed pineapple is a star ingredient, adding moisture, sweetness, and a subtle tang that complements the carrots and spices beautifully. It also contains enzymes that help tenderize the cake. The key is to drain off all the juices thoroughly before adding it to the batter; excess liquid can throw off the cake’s consistency.
- Cream Cheese (Room Temperature for Smooth Frosting): For the iconic cream cheese frosting, Philadelphia brand cream cheese is a go-to for its consistent quality. Crucially, ensure both your cream cheese and butter are at room temperature. This allows them to blend together smoothly without lumps, creating a light, airy, and spreadable frosting.
- Butter (Room Temperature for Frosting): Like cream cheese, butter for the frosting must be at room temperature. Softened butter creams beautifully with cream cheese and powdered sugar, resulting in a velvety smooth texture.
- Powdered Sugar (Sift for Silky Smoothness): Powdered sugar (confectioners’ sugar) is essential for the frosting’s sweetness and texture. Sifting it before adding to the cream cheese and butter mixture is highly recommended. This step removes any lumps, guaranteeing a truly silky, smooth frosting that glides onto your cake.

The Ultimate Classic Carrot Cake: A Recipe for Every Occasion
Among the many carrot cake recipes my mom meticulously tested on us during the 1970s, one from The New Basics Cookbook quickly emerged as the gold standard. It possessed a perfect balance of moistness, spice, and texture, setting an impossibly high bar for all other carrot cakes. This isn’t just a recipe; it’s a culinary journey, accompanying me and my loved ones through countless memorable moments. From a serene retreat in Harbor Springs, Michigan, to a lively Halloween party in Brown County, Indiana, a dear friend’s milestone 50th birthday celebration, and even to the cardiac cath lab where my husband Bill works, this cake has spread joy and deliciousness far and wide.
Whether I choose to bake a half batch of this Classic Carrot Cake with Pineapple, Coconut, and Pecans in a simpler 9×13 pan or dedicate myself to crafting this magnificent layered masterpiece, it is consistently adored by all who indulge. Its adaptability makes it perfect for any setting, from a casual gathering to a grand celebration. For those longer journeys, I often prepare and freeze the cake, then transport it in a cooler. The recipients are always thrilled by the extra effort and the exquisite taste of this homemade treat. Most recently, this pictured carrot cake was the star of our annual 4th of July cookout, enjoyed by friends and family alike, with a few lucky guests even taking home extra slices to savor later. Its ability to travel well and impress effortlessly makes it a truly versatile and beloved dessert.
If your passion for carrot cake extends to other decadent flavors, you might love exploring variations. For instance, if you adore caramel, this Caramel Filled Carrot Cake promises to be a game-changer. It’s a fantastic option for Easter or any special occasion where you want to truly impress. And if the creamy indulgence of cheesecake is more your style, this Carrot Cake Cheesecake from Taste and Tell looks absolutely fabulous and is sure to be a showstopper!
For those who prefer bite-sized delights, there are plenty of creative options that capture the essence of carrot cake. These Giant Carrot Cake Cookie Cups from Wishes and Dishes offer a fun, portable treat. If you’re looking to enjoy carrot cake for breakfast or brunch, the Carrot Cake Scones with Maple Cream Cheese Glaze from A Beautiful Plate are an elegant choice. And for another wonderfully portable and charming dessert, my own Carrot Cake Whoopie Pies are an absolute delight!
Baking Perfection: Expert Tips for the Ultimate Carrot Cake
As a self-proclaimed carrot cake aficionado, I can confidently say this recipe consistently delivers the best carrot cake I’ve ever tasted. Its dense, moist crumb, combined with the perfect balance of nuts, coconut, and pineapple, guarantees rave reviews every time. Here are some expert tips to help you achieve perfection in your kitchen:
- PRO-Tip: Toast Your Nuts for Deeper Flavor. To enhance the nutty flavor and aroma, always toast your pecans before adding them to the batter. This simple step brings out their natural oils, resulting in a richer, more complex taste. Spread them on a baking sheet and toast in a preheated oven at 350°F (175°C) for 5-7 minutes, or in a dry skillet over medium heat, stirring frequently, until fragrant. If you have a nut allergy or simply prefer a nut-free cake, feel free to omit them entirely.
- Pureed Carrots for Superior Texture. This recipe specifically calls for cooked and pureed carrots. This method ensures that the carrots are evenly distributed throughout the batter, contributing to a smooth, consistent texture in every bite, rather than producing noticeable chunks. I typically cook and drain about 2 cups of sliced carrots, then puree them to yield the 1⅓ cups needed for the recipe. If you encounter other recipes that call for grated carrots, make sure to grate them very finely. Finer grating promotes better dispersion compared to coarsely grated carrots, which can clump together.
- Embrace the Pineapple. If you’re new to carrot cake, the inclusion of pineapple might seem unusual, but it’s a truly wonderful addition. Crushed pineapple not only introduces a delightful sweetness and tangy note but also adds significant moisture to the cake. Furthermore, pineapple contains bromelain, an enzyme that tenderizes proteins, contributing to the cake’s incredibly soft and tender crumb. Remember to drain the crushed pineapple thoroughly to avoid excess moisture in your batter.
- PRO-Tip: Vegetable Oil for Unbeatable Moisture. A key to this cake’s exceptional moistness is the use of vegetable oil instead of butter in the cake batter. Oil remains liquid at room temperature, keeping the cake tender and moist for longer. While butter adds flavor, there’s ample flavor from the carrots, spices, nuts, and coconut in this recipe, so the absence of butter in the cake itself does not detract from its rich taste.
- Effortless Layering and Frosting. One of the many joys of this particular recipe is how reliably it bakes up flat. This characteristic makes the process of layering and frosting the cake incredibly easy and stress-free, ensuring a professional-looking finish every time.
- Freezing for Future Enjoyment. Carrot cake, whether frosted or unfrosted, freezes exceptionally well, making it a perfect make-ahead dessert.
- PRO-Tip: Freezing Unfrosted Layers. You can bake the cake layers in advance, allow them to cool completely, then wrap them tightly in plastic wrap and aluminum foil. Store these unfrosted layers in the freezer for up to 3 months, and they will likely last even longer without losing quality. This is a fantastic way to break up the baking process.
- Freezing a Frosted Cake. If you’ve already frosted your cake and wish to save it for later, simply place the frosted cake in the freezer for a few hours. This allows the cream cheese frosting to firm up. Once the frosting is hard, wrap the entire cake well with plastic wrap and then with aluminum foil to prevent freezer burn. To enjoy, simply defrost the cake overnight in the refrigerator.

Frequently Asked Questions About Carrot Cake
A classic carrot cake is a symphony of flavors and textures. It’s wonderfully dense and moist, infused with warm spices like cinnamon, and often complemented by a hint of nutmeg or ginger. The star, carrots, lend a subtle earthy sweetness without being overtly vegetable-like. This rich base is then crowned with a sweet, tangy, and incredibly smooth cream cheese frosting, which provides a perfect counterpoint to the cake’s depth of flavor. Ingredients like pecans, coconut, and pineapple add layers of crunch, chewiness, and tropical brightness.
This particular recipe is already generously loaded with pecans, crushed pineapple, and shredded coconut, along with the essential pureed carrots. However, the versatility of carrot cake allows for many delicious additions. Common enhancements include raisins or dried cranberries for extra chewiness and sweetness. You can easily substitute walnuts for pecans if you prefer their flavor profile. Some recipes also call for applesauce, which can further boost moisture and add a touch of fruity sweetness while potentially reducing the amount of oil needed.
Carrots are naturally sensitive to pH levels. If they come into contact with highly alkaline ingredients, such as baking soda (sodium bicarbonate), their natural pigments can react and sometimes cause them to turn a dark, greenish, or even blackish hue. This discoloration can then spread throughout the cake. While it can be startling, it’s generally harmless and doesn’t affect the cake’s taste or edibility. Fortunately, with this recipe, I have never encountered this phenomenon, but it’s good to be aware that it can occasionally happen.
While this specific recipe uses all-purpose flour, many bakers have successfully adapted carrot cake recipes to be gluten-free. You would typically substitute the all-purpose flour with a high-quality gluten-free all-purpose flour blend, preferably one that already contains xanthan gum. Ensure all other ingredients are also certified gluten-free. Adjustments to liquid might be needed, so always follow the specific instructions of your chosen gluten-free flour blend.
Due to the cream cheese frosting, carrot cake should always be stored in the refrigerator. Place it in an airtight container or cover it loosely with plastic wrap to prevent it from drying out. It will stay fresh for up to 3-5 days. For longer storage, as mentioned in our expert tips, the cake (frosted or unfrosted) freezes beautifully.
Explore More Delicious Cake Creations
If you’ve enjoyed this classic carrot cake, you’re sure to find delight in these other fantastic cake recipes and variations:
- Carrot Cake Cheesecake from Taste and Tell
- Giant Carrot Cake Cookie Cups from Wishes and Dishes
- Carrot Cake Whoopie Pies
- German Chocolate Cake
- Caramel Filled Carrot Cake
- Discover even more incredible Cake Recipes for every occasion!
We love to see your baking creations! Stay in touch through social media—find us on Instagram, Facebook, and Pinterest. Don’t forget to tag us when you try one of our recipes! Your feedback is invaluable; if you love the results, please consider giving it a 5-star rating in the recipe card below.

Classic Carrot Cake Recipe
20 minutes
1 hour
1 hour 20 minutes
16 servings
A loaded two layer carrot cake with a dreamy cream cheese frosting
Rated 4.9/5 stars by 68 readers
Ingredients
Cake:
- 3 cups flour
- 3 cups sugar
- 1 teaspoon salt
- 1 tablespoon baking powder
- 1 tablespoon cinnamon
- 1 ½ cups vegetable oil
- 4 eggs, beaten slightly
- 1 tablespoon vanilla extract
- 1 ½ cups well chopped pecans (plus more to garnish if desired)
- 1 ½ cups shredded coconut
- 1 ⅓ cups pureed cooked carrots*
- ¾ cup drained crushed pineapple
Frosting:
- 8 ounces cream cheese at room temperature
- 6 tablespoons butter at room temperature
- 3 cups powdered sugar, sifted
- 1 teaspoon vanilla extract
Instructions
- Preheat oven to 350ºF (175ºC). Grease two 9-inch round cake pans; line the bottoms with parchment paper. Grease the parchment paper as well.
- In a large bowl, sift or thoroughly whisk together the dry ingredients: flour, sugar, salt, baking powder, and cinnamon.
- To the dry ingredients, add the vegetable oil, slightly beaten eggs, and vanilla extract. Beat until all ingredients are well combined and the batter is smooth.
- Gently fold in the chopped pecans, shredded coconut, pureed cooked carrots, and thoroughly drained crushed pineapple until just combined. Be careful not to overmix.
- Divide the batter evenly between the two prepared cake pans. Bake for 30-40 minutes (note: some heavy cake pans may require closer to one hour). The cakes are done when the edges pull away slightly from the sides of the pan and a wooden skewer or toothpick inserted into the center comes out clean.
- Allow the cakes to cool in their pans for 10 minutes. Then, carefully invert them onto wire cooling racks to cool completely, about 3 hours, before frosting.
- To make the frosting: In a large bowl, beat the softened cream cheese and butter together until smooth and creamy. Gradually sift the powdered sugar into the bowl, mixing well until no lumps remain and the frosting is smooth.
- Add the vanilla extract to the frosting and mix until well combined. Frost the cooled cake layers as desired, spreading evenly between layers and over the top and sides.
Notes
Adapted from The New Basics Cookbook.
To prepare 1 ⅓ cups of pureed carrots, you will typically need to cook and drain about 2 cups of sliced carrots before pureeing them.
Recommended Products for Baking Success
As an Amazon Associate and member of other affiliate programs, I earn from qualifying purchases.
- Silicone Spatulas
- KitchenAid 9-Speed Digital Hand Mixer
- 9-inch Parchment Rounds
- 9-inch USA Pan Bakeware Round Cake Pan
- Baking Rack Cooling Rack Set of 2
- Food Processor
Nutrition Information:
Yield:
16
Serving Size:
1 slice
Amount Per Serving:
Calories: 720Total Fat: 41gSaturated Fat: 10gTrans Fat: 1gUnsaturated Fat: 28gCholesterol: 72mgSodium: 383mgCarbohydrates: 86gFiber: 3gSugar: 64gProtein: 6g
HOW MUCH DID YOU LOVE THIS RECIPE?
Please leave a comment on the blog or share a photo on Pinterest

